Summary
This position involves donor screening, customer service, and whole blood collection. All protocols are clearly documented and taught using inclusive and recurring training sessions. A phlebotomist in this position might work at a fixed donor center location or at various community sites via mobile blood drives and will work with a variety of donors each shift.

Job Responsibilities
- Assess and document vitals of presenting donors to determine eligibility.
- Perform blood collection (phlebotomy) in accordance with applicable policies and safety procedures.
- Provide excellent customer service and pre/post donation care as needed.
- Assist with the setup of community blood drives including the safe loading/unloading of mobile units.
- Perform cleaning tasks, including equipment cleaning.
- Ensure accuracy, acceptability, and completeness of documentation to prevent loss of units.
- Attend and participate in staff meetings and trainings.

Founded in 1948, Memorial Blood Centers (MBC), operated by New York Blood Center Enterprises, is one of the largest community-based, nonprofit blood collection and distribution organizations in the United States. MBC operates 10 donor centers in Minnesota and western Wisconsin and provides blood products, accredited reference lab services, infectious disease testing, and IVF/Reproductive Medicine services to 41 area hospitals.
